Additive Manufacturing Without Direct Powder Contact
ADDiTEC’s LPBF platform cleans printed parts in a controlled environment.

ADDiTEC’s laser powder bed fusion (LPBF) platform, Fusion S, is designed for smaller applications in industries like aerospace, defense, medical, energy and tooling. It's known for its compact size, high-resolution printing, and a fully enclosed cartridge system for safe powder handling and transport. The Fusion S also includes the Fusion Cabin unpacking station, which allows for cleaning of printed parts in a controlled environment.
Benefits of the Fusion S include:
- High-resolution printing for complex geometries and fine features
- Compact footprint with integrated powder handling and post-processing capabilities
- Industrial-grade performance in a user-friendly, turnkey package
- Unique closed powder architecture to enable operation without direct contact with metal powder
The platform supports optimized print parameters for various advanced alloys, including titanium, stainless steel and cobalt chrome.
